Cork County Council in Trojan horse-style ‘stroke’

A veteran Cork City councillor has accused the county council of a Trojan horse-style ‘stroke’ designed to delay and frustrate the implementation of a city boundary extension.

Fianna Fáil councillor Tim Brosnan made the comments yesterday following confirmation that members of Cork County Council have unanimously agreed to submit a formal boundary alteration to the city council. The process could take several months.

“It is cynical, myopic, and self-serving,” he said.
